NerdWallet Logo

NerdWallet

Senior Manager, Software Engineering (Platform Systems) - Canada

Posted 5 Days Ago
Be an Early Applicant
Remote
Hiring Remotely in Canada
Senior level
Remote
Hiring Remotely in Canada
Senior level
Lead and grow an engineering team that owns NerdWallet's platform systems (Content Platform, CMS, Product Data Platform). Partner with Product and cross-functional teams to prioritize roadmap, ensure technical quality, drive architecture and modernization, enforce engineering best practices, manage delivery and availability, and mentor engineers while balancing short-term delivery with long-term maintainability, security, and compliance.
The summary above was generated by AI

At NerdWallet, we’re on a mission to bring clarity to all of life’s financial decisions, and every great mission needs a team of exceptional Nerds. We’ve built an inclusive, flexible, and candid culture where you’re empowered to grow, take smart risks, and be unapologetically yourself (cape optional). Whether remote or in-office, we support how you thrive best. We invest in your well-being, development, and ability to make an impact​ because when one Nerd levels up, we all do.

NerdWallet’s Platform team builds and operates the foundational systems that power our consumer experience. They own our centralized product data platform, partner ingestion pipelines, publishing and click-tracking infrastructure, GraphQL gateway operations, and our high-traffic, headless WordPress CMS. These platforms ensure accurate, compliant, and high-performance product and content experiences across web and mobile for millions of users. We’re looking for a Senior Engineering Manager to lead this team, driving the modernization of legacy services into scalable, reliable systems and advancing our vision of a decoupled, flexible platform that enables faster publishing, stronger observability, and future growth.

As Senior Engineering Manager for our Platform Systems, you’ll lead and support a team of engineers delivering high-quality, scalable, and secure software that advances NerdWallet’s product and business goals. You’ll partner closely with Product and cross-functional collaborators to shape the roadmap, prioritize work, and remove obstacles, while fostering strong engineering practices and a culture of continuous learning. You’ll be accountable for technical quality, team health, and day-to-day execution—mentoring and developing engineers, making thoughtful technical decisions, and balancing near-term delivery with long-term maintainability, compliance, and reliability.

This role reports to the Director, Engineering.


Where you can make an impact:
  • Lead, coach, and develop an engineering team responsible for NerdWallet’s platform systems, including the Content Platform, CMS, and Product Data Platform

  • Partner with Product Managers and other cross-functional stakeholders to plan, prioritize, and execute against the product roadmap

  • Drive consistent execution of software development best practices, including code quality, testing, documentation, and operational excellence

  • Contribute to and guide technical and architectural decisions, ensuring solutions are scalable, reliable, secure, and compliant with regulatory requirements

  • Balance platform evolution (e.g., headless CMS, APIs, content workflows) with stability for high-traffic, mission critical systems

  • Manage sprint planning, project timelines, and delivery commitments, ensuring predictable and high-quality execution

  • Identify technical risks, dependencies, and delivery challenges, escalating and addressing them proactively

  • Foster a culture of collaboration, accountability, continuous improvement, and psychological safety

  • Support hiring, onboarding, performance management, and career development for engineers at varying levels

  • Ensure systems owned by the team meet availability, performance, and security standards

Your experience:
  • 8+ years of relevant software engineering experience

  • 5+ years of experience as the people manager of an engineering team

  • Proven experience delivering production software in a complex, fast-paced environment within FinTech or regulated industries

  • Proven success owning and leading large-scale content management systems and headless architectures (our current platform is built on WordPress)

  • Proven success leading large scale backend systems

  • Strong understanding of the software development life cycle, agile methodologies, and modern engineering practices

  • Solid technical foundation with experience designing and building scalable, reliable, and secure systems

  • Proficient in either PHP or Python, GraphQL, SQL, and TypeScript

  • Working knowledge of security best practices, data privacy, and compliance considerations in financial systems

  • Demonstrated ability to coach, mentor, and support engineers at varying levels through clear, actionable feedback

  • Strong communication and collaboration skills, with the ability to work effectively with technical and non-technical partners

  • Experience balancing delivery commitments with technical quality and long-term maintainability

  • Experience in developing scalable web applications with SEO in mind

  • Strong problem-solving and decision-making skills, with a proven ability to manage and deliver complex engineering projects at scale and on time

  • A passion for mentorship, cross-functional collaboration, and creating inclusive, high-performing teams

Where:
  • This is a remote position and a person can be located anywhere in Canada (with the exception of Quebec).

  • NerdWallet is proud to be a remote-first company! We believe great work can be done anywhere. No matter where you are based, NerdWallet offers benefits and perks to support the physical, financial, and emotional well being of you and your family.

What we offer:

Work Hard, Stay Balanced (Life’s a series of balancing acts, eh?)

  • Monthly Healthcare Stipend

  • Rejuvenation Policy – Vacation Time Off + You will receive the official public holidays in your province

  • Paid sabbatical for Nerds to recharge, gain knowledge and pursue their interests

  • Monthly Wellness Stipend, Wifi Stipend, and Cell Phone Stipend

  • Work from home equipment stipend 

Have Some Fun! (Nerds are fun, too)

  • Nerd-led group initiatives – Employee Resource Groups for Parents, Diversity, and Inclusion, Women, LGBTQIA, and other communities

  • Hackathons and team events across all teams and departments

  • Company-wide events like NerdLove (employee appreciation) and our annual Charity Auction 

Plan for your future (And when you retire on your island, remember the little people)

  • RRSP with a 4% match. Eligible one month after hire. 

  • Financial wellness, guidance, and unlimited access to a Certified Financial Planner (CFP) through Northstar

NerdWallet is committed to pursuing and hiring a diverse workforce and is proud to be an equal opportunity employer. We prohibit discrimination and harassment on the basis of any characteristic protected by applicable federal, state, or local law, so all qualified applicants will receive consideration for employment. 

#LI-Remote

Top Skills

Php,Python,Graphql,Sql,Typescript,Wordpress,Headless Cms,Apis

Similar Jobs

12 Hours Ago
Remote or Hybrid
2 Locations
Mid level
Mid level
Cloud • Insurance • Payments • Software • Business Intelligence • App development • Big Data Analytics
Drive product operations focusing on GTM and post-launch processes, optimize workflows, manage cross-functional projects, and mentor team members.
Top Skills: Jira Advanced RoadmapsJira Product DiscoveryPendo
14 Hours Ago
Remote
Canada
Senior level
Senior level
Cloud • Fintech • Food • Information Technology • Software • Hospitality
As a Senior Software Engineer, you'll design and implement solutions, mentor junior engineers, and optimize systems for restaurant delivery services.
Top Skills: JavaJavaScriptKotlinReactScalaTypescript
16 Hours Ago
Remote or Hybrid
Ontario, ON, CAN
Senior level
Senior level
eCommerce • Fintech • Real Estate • Software • PropTech
The Director of Brand Design will lead the design vision, strategy, and execution for the brand identity. This role focuses on creating a compelling brand experience and ensuring consistency across all platforms and touchpoints, aligning design strategy with business goals.

What you need to know about the Vancouver Tech Scene

Raincouver, Vancity, The Big Smoke — Vancouver is known by many names, and in recent years, it has gained a reputation as a growing hub for both tech and sustainability. Renowned for its natural beauty, the city has become a magnet for professionals eager to create environmental solutions, and with an emphasis on clean technology, renewable energy and environmental innovation, it's attracted companies across various industries, all working toward a shared goal: advancing clean technology.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account